
He is a master of disguise and she a master of the hunt, and their chase resumes. Picking up where the television series left off, the film deepens the show’s mythology, offering a revealing glimpse of how Jarod originally escaped the Centre. Now he must infiltrate the NSA to capture a ruthless assassin who may be another Pretender from his past.

The story reunites the entire cast from the series, picking up right after the season four cliffhanger. Jarod, Michael T. Weiss, along with Ethan and Miss Parker, is alive after the bomb on the train, and Jarod is now posing as an agent for the National Security Agency, part of a task force determined to track down the elusive “Chameleon,” a killer who embodies all the adaptive traits of a Pretender.
The Centre is forced to pause its Hunt for Jarod when its administrator, Harve Presnell as Mr. Parker, is abducted. Miss Parker discovers that Richard Marcus as William Raines is still alive, despite being allegedly killed by her father. Her brother, James Denton as Mr. Lyle, tries to finish Raines off, but Miss Parker manages to spirit him away and hide him in her house. In return, Raines agrees to shed light on who might have kidnapped her father.
Jarod begins receiving taunting clues from the Chameleon, leading him to believe the killer bears a personal grudge against him. This revelation takes Jarod back to the days before his escape from the Centre; he hatched a plan with two fellow Pretenders, including a man named Alex, played by Peter Outerbridge. Alex was captured during their escape and endured horrific torture by his captors; now he seeks revenge on Jarod. From his perspective, Alex found his own family and murdered them, claiming this freed him from the Centre’s control, yet he remains unsatisfied and kidnaps Mr. Parker with the intent to kill him.
After incriminating evidence points to Jarod, his NSA colleagues suspect him of being the Chameleon. The Centre’s programmer, Jon Gries as Broots, is swept up in the NSA investigation and pulled into an interrogation room. Jarod instantly recognizes Broots, but chooses to cover for him rather than risk exposing them both. As Jarod escorts Broots out of the NSA building, Jarod’s partners move in to arrest them both. Jarod flees in a vehicle with Broots in tow, then later abandons him by the roadside.
In the climactic sequence, Jarod thwarts Alex’s next assassination and helps free Mr. Parker. Before Alex commits suicide, he taunts that the truth of Jarod’s real identity will die with him. Mr. Parker is injured during the struggle and rendered catatonic. As Jarod and Miss Parker speak on the phone, both receive an anonymous email containing an image of two women—the mothers of Miss Parker and Jarod—standing together. The email is revealed to have been sent by Richard Marcus himself, apparently as a show of thanks for rescuing him.
